Lol, do you know how bitcoin works on even the most superficial level?

I know that when the cost of electricity for making a bitcoin is close to 50% of the price of a bitcoin for some, expanding your mining operation by adding more overhead is not really a given, not to mention the cost of the actual HW. And as far as I know, the mining gear developers are reluctant to put all their money into 14/16nm FinFet processes when the prices drop like an anvil. So I was wondering if you have some specific information on why the hashrate would go "way up" anytime soon?
